The NBA's rule on HS players having to wait until they are 19 or at least one year past their HS graduation is probably going to be nixed due to some court cases that are floating about.

What about the NFL rule regarding waiting at least three years past High School graduation? How likely is that to pass the test of time?

There are numerous examples of NBA players who under the old rules went straight to the NBA from HS such as Lebron James, Kevin Garnett and Darrell Dawkins. They were significant players immediately.

Who would be a High Schooler who could go straight to the NFL and make an immediate impact?

I can only come up with:

1. Herschel Walker
2. Bo Jackson

I just don't think an Aaron Donald, Lawrence Taylor, Eric Dickerson, or anyone else would have the strength, maturity, or stamina to do it. Certainly no QB could come straight out of HS and play right away.

Walker and Jackson were just freaks of nature that come along every millennium.
